Why Shenzhen Dominates Egg Rider V2 Display Manufacturing
Shenzhen, located in Guangdong Province, China, remains the global epicenter for advanced optoelectronic component production. Its dominance in Egg Rider V2 display manufacturing stems from a deeply integrated electronics ecosystem that combines R&D innovation, precision manufacturing, and rapid logistics.
The city hosts industrial clusters in districts like Bao'an and Longgang, where suppliers benefit from proximity to semiconductor suppliers, SMT (Surface Mount Technology) assembly lines, and testing laboratories. This concentration reduces component lead times by up to 40% compared to alternative regions and enables agile prototyping cycles—critical for businesses iterating on firmware or custom UI designs.
Additionally, Shenzhen’s access to major ports such as Shekou and international airports streamlines export operations, making it ideal for global buyers managing just-in-time inventory models.
While Taiwan and Vietnam are emerging as lower-cost alternatives with improving technical capabilities, they still lack the supply chain depth and engineering talent pool found in Shenzhen. Over 75% of all e-bike display modules—including key ICs, LCD panels, and touch overlays—are manufactured within this region, reinforcing its strategic importance.
Key Criteria for Selecting an Egg Rider V2 Display Supplier
Choosing the right supplier goes beyond price. For long-term reliability and scalability, procurement teams should evaluate partners based on quality assurance, technical capability, responsiveness, and operational transparency.
1. Certifications and Compliance Standards
Prioritize suppliers with recognized quality management certifications such as ISO 9001 or IATF 16949 (automotive-specific). These indicate adherence to rigorous processes for defect control, environmental resilience, and consistent output—especially important for displays exposed to vibration, moisture, and temperature extremes.
Look for products rated IP67 or higher, ensuring dust-tight sealing and short-term water immersion resistance. This is non-negotiable for e-bike applications subject to rain, mud, and frequent cleaning.
2. Production Capacity and Scalability
A supplier’s ability to scale depends on factory size, staffing levels, and automation infrastructure. Aim for manufacturers operating facilities over 3,000 m² with dedicated engineering teams of 40+ technicians. Larger workforces support parallel development tracks, faster troubleshooting, and sustained high-volume output without bottlenecks.
3. Technical Validation and Component Traceability
Before committing, conduct thorough technical evaluations:
- Sample Testing: Assess performance under extreme temperatures (-20°C to 60°C), sunlight readability (≥500 cd/m² brightness), and mechanical durability.
- Component Verification: Request full bill-of-materials (BOM) documentation to confirm use of genuine ICs and branded LCD panels, minimizing risks of counterfeit parts.
- Protocol Compatibility: Ensure Bluetooth 5.0/BLE integration aligns with your existing e-bike control systems and mobile app architecture.
4. Operational Responsiveness and Track Record
Use third-party platforms like Alibaba.com, Global Sources, or Made-in-China to review verified transaction histories. Key metrics include:
- On-time delivery rate ≥97%
- Average response time ≤8 hours (ideally under 3 hours)
- Customer reorder rate (indicates post-sale satisfaction)
Suppliers meeting these benchmarks typically demonstrate strong internal coordination and customer-centric operations.

Frequently Asked Questions (FAQs)
How do I verify an Egg Rider V2 display supplier’s reliability?
Cross-check ISO/RoHS certifications, request video factory audits, and validate transaction history via trusted B2B platforms. Ask for customer references and conduct sample stress tests before placing bulk orders.
What is the typical MOQ for customized Egg Rider V2 displays?
Most established suppliers require 500–1,000 units for custom branding, firmware modifications, or UI redesigns. Newer or trading companies may accept lower MOQs (as low as 300 units) but often charge higher per-unit costs or setup fees.
Do suppliers provide free samples?
Yes—many reputable manufacturers offer one or two free samples to qualified B2B buyers. Shipping costs are usually borne by the buyer, though some suppliers cover domestic freight. Startups may be asked to pay a nominal fee (up to $50) to deter non-serious inquiries.
Can I visit the supplier’s factory in Shenzhen?
Absolutely. Leading suppliers such as Shenzhen Biosled Technology Co., Ltd. welcome factory visits by appointment. Plan 2–3 weeks in advance to schedule technical demonstrations, QC walkthroughs, and meetings with engineering leads.
How long does the sampling process take?
After finalizing design specifications, expect prototype delivery in 10–15 days. Expedited services (5–7 days) are available from select suppliers for an additional 20–30% fee—useful during urgent development phases.
